Configuring XBMC Advanced

The XBMC Advanced remote control provides additional status information and control. However, you need to configure XBMC to allow Unified Remote to control XBMC. By default Unified Remote Server is configured to control XBMC running on the same computer. It is however possible to control a different computer by changing the "host" setting for the remote in the server manager.

  1. Make sure you have the latest version of XBMC installed.
  2. Open XBMC on your computer. 
  3. Choose "System" > "Settings" from the main menu.
  4. Choose "Services" in the menu.
  5. Select "Webserver". 
  6. Make sure "Allow control of XBMC via HTTP" is enabled. 
  7. Also, change the "Port" to 8080.
